Grants
Grants are an integral part of the District 112 Foundation's mission in helping teachers succeed in their classrooms.  The Foundation fulfills numerous grant requests each year to be implemented in our schools.  We hope you will take the time to apply.  Grant applications are due in the spring of each year.
